Blocked Layers
Активный0.0
Установок
Последнее обновление
Blocked Layers
Данный мод позволяет создавать простые задания, которые открывают игроку доступ к более глубоким слоям подземного мира. Для версии 1.7.10 и выше, начиная с релиза 2.0.
После установки мода в папке config/BlockedLayers автоматически создается файл quests.json. Разрушать блоки под определенным слоем можно только после выполнения всех заданий на этом уровне.
Настройка заданий
Каждое задание настраивается через JSON-файл со следующими параметрами:
- name: уникальное название задания
- activity: тип действия (eat, break, kill, harvest, loot, own, consume, xp, find, craft)
- object: целевой объект для действия
- modID: идентификатор мода (для ванильных объектов - minecraft)
- text: описание задания для игрока
- layer: номер слоя от 1 до 255
- meta: метаданные (обычно 0, -1 для любых значений)
- number: требуемое количество (максимум 2147483647)
Типы действий
- eat: употребление пищи
- break: разрушение блоков
- kill: уничтожение существ
- harvest: сбор урожая с блоков
- loot: добыча с существ
- own: наличие предметов в инвентаре
- consume: использование предметов с их исчезновением
- xp: получение опыта
- find: обнаружение биома
- craft: создание или плавка предметов
Командный режим
Игроки могут объединяться в команды (опция отключается в настройках). Участники одной команды делятся прогрессом выполнения заданий. Для вступления в команду используйте команду:
/bl team <игрок> <название_команды>
Пример: /bl team Notch Masters
Сброс прогресса
Для сброса прогресса доступна команда:
/bl reset quest|layer <игрок> <слой|задание>
Примеры:
/bl reset quest Dinnerbone deathOfChicken/bl reset layer Dinnerbone 32
При сбросе слоя обнуляются все задания на этом уровне.
Система наград
В настройках можно активировать систему вознаграждений. Файл config/BlockedLayers/rewards.json позволяет добавлять предметы в формате "modID:itemID:meta:number" или "oreDictionaryName:number". При достижении нового слоя игрок автоматически получает указанные награды.
Отслеживание прогресса
Для просмотра текущего прогресса используйте горячую клавишу (по умолчанию L), которая открывает специальную панель.

Важные заметки
- Не используйте Shift для быстрого извлечения предметов из верстака или печи - это может привести к некорректному подсчету
- Для получения правильных modID и itemID используйте функцию дампа в NEI